Product Overview

The Schneider ATV320U22S6C Variable Speed Drive is a high-performance AC drive from the Altivar Machine ATV320 series, designed to deliver reliable motor speed regulation, energy-efficient operation, and flexible machine control for modern industrial automation systems. The drive is suitable for controlling compatible three-phase asynchronous and synchronous motors used in a wide range of industrial equipment.

Designed with OEM machine builders and industrial users in mind, the ATV320U22S6C combines compact construction, advanced motor control technology, integrated safety features, and industrial communication capabilities within a robust enclosure. By accurately controlling motor speed and torque, the drive improves production efficiency, minimizes mechanical wear, and reduces energy consumption throughout the equipment lifecycle.

The drive is widely applied in packaging machinery, material handling equipment, conveyor systems, food and beverage processing, textile machinery, woodworking equipment, pumps, fans, compressors, and other industrial automation applications requiring precise and stable motor control.

With overall dimensions of 140 × 184 × 158 mm and an approximate weight of 2 kg, the ATV320U22S6C offers a compact installation solution for industrial control cabinets while providing reliable performance under continuous-duty operating conditions.

Function and Working Principle

The ATV320U22S6C converts fixed-frequency AC input power into a controlled variable-frequency and variable-voltage output, allowing the connected motor to operate at the speed required by the application.

A simplified operating sequence is:

AC Power Supply → Rectifier → DC Bus → Inverter → AC Motor → Mechanical Equipment

The drive continuously monitors operating conditions and adjusts its output to maintain stable motor performance.

Installation and Commissioning

Before installation, engineers should verify:

  • Power supply compatibility
  • Motor specifications
  • Cabinet ventilation
  • Protective grounding
  • Cable sizing
  • Control wiring
  • Communication configuration
  • Environmental conditions

Recommended Installation Procedure

  1. Disconnect electrical power.
  2. Mount the drive vertically inside the control cabinet.
  3. Connect the input power supply.
  4. Connect the motor output terminals.
  5. Connect protective earth.
  6. Wire the control terminals.
  7. Connect communication interfaces if required.
  8. Inspect all electrical connections.
  9. Restore power.
  10. Configure motor parameters.
  11. Set acceleration and deceleration times.
  12. Configure protection settings.
  13. Perform motor rotation testing.
  14. Verify communication with the automation system.
  15. Complete commissioning and functional testing.

Correct installation contributes to stable long-term operation and reliable motor performance.
